When a spouse is in the military, they are protected by the soldiers and sailors civil relief act. For spouses who wish to file for divorce in utah, the person who is filing for the divorce must have been a resident of utah, or have been serving in the armed forces in utah, for at least three months prior to filing. To open your divorce case, you must file your forms in the clerk�s office of the court in the county where you live.
